The benefits of Leadership Iowa, the ABI Foundation’s premier statewide issues-awareness program, transcend well-beyond exploration of our great state. The program serves as the foundation for lasting connections that enrich the lives of participants both personally and professionally.
Throughout the nine-month program, attendees engage in candid discussions, shared experiences, and collaborative projects that cultivate trust and camaraderie. These interactions lay the groundwork for meaningful friendships and foster a network of trusted confidants representing diverse industries, backgrounds, and communities across Iowa.
These same connections have been known to evolve into collaborative business partnerships and professional alliances. Whether launching joint ventures, exchanging expertise, or offering career support, participants can leverage their network to enhance opportunities for themselves and others.
“Throughout the Leadership Iowa program, I had the opportunity to connect with classmates who are also professional peers from across the state. Even now, we continue to exchange advice and collaborate on common challenges, despite being on opposite sides of Iowa,” said Ryan Waller (LI ’23-24; City of Marion). “One unexpected benefit has been the cross-industry collaboration. It’s opened my eyes to just how interconnected our work really is.
These connections also extend far beyond business and professional ties, however. The program’s legacy is one of enduring community – an interconnected group of leaders dedicated to supporting one another even with personal challenges, community involvement and more.
“My wife and I founded a nonprofit foundation, Do Better. Be Better, to support families facing medical emergencies in and around the Cedar Valley,” said Patrick Smith (LI ’21-22; First Bank). “I could have never anticipated that my LI class members would become some of our most dedicated supporters. I’m so grateful for this network, one I am proud to call family”.
The program’s immersive nature fosters deep bonds among class members, bonds that not only serve as the backbone of a vibrant professional network, but also create a support system that extends far beyond the nine-month program.
